Wapicada Village - Mayhew Park is undeveloped at this time. The terrain and location in the Watab Creek floodplain make it difficult to access or develop. An abandoned railroad right-of-way (now privately owned) goes through this property. State Highway 23 is to the south of the park and County State Aid 8 to the north and west of the park.
Improvements and amenities rated the highest in priorities that residents wish to see in the future are bicycle/pedestrian trail with bridge for access and develop primitive camping/picnicking.
